Visual Basic程序设计实务PDF电子书下载
- 电子书积分:15 积分如何计算积分?
- 作 者:杨宏宇主编;彭丽副主编
- 出 版 社:北京:中央广播电视大学出版社
- 出版年份:2012
- ISBN:9787304057435
- 页数:461 页
第1章 V语言概述 1
1.1 VB的基本概念 3
1.1.1 VB的发展历史 3
1.1.2 VB的基本特点 3
1.1.3面向对象的程序设计方法 4
1.1.4可视化程序设计方法 4
1.1.5事件驱动的编程机制 5
1.1.6提供软件集成开发环境 5
1.1.7结构化设计语言,功能强大 5
1.2启动VB 5
1.3退出VB 7
1.4 VB的集成开发环境 8
1.4.1标题栏 8
1.4.2菜单栏 8
1.4.3工具栏 9
1.4.4工具箱 10
1.4.5工程资源管理器窗口 11
1.4.6属性窗口 11
1.4.7窗体设计器 12
1.5对象浏览器 13
1.5.1显示对象浏览器 13
1.5.2对象浏览器内容介绍 13
1.6使用VB帮助系统 14
第2章 可视化编程的基本概念 17
2.1时钟显示程序设计示例 19
2.1.1界面设计 19
2.1.2编写代码 20
2.1.3保存应用程序 22
2.1.4运行程序 22
2.2 VB应用程序的特点 23
2.2.1可视化设计 23
2.2.2事件驱动编程 24
2.3对象与事件驱动概念 25
2.3.1对象、属性、类 25
2.3.2方法与事件 26
2.3.3事件驱动程序设计 28
2.4 VB中的常用控件介绍 29
2.4.1标签控件(Label) 31
2.4.2文本框控件(Text) 33
2.4.3命令按钮控件(CommandButton) 35
2.4.4单选按钮控件(OptionButton) 39
2.4.5复选框控件(CheckBox) 41
2.4.6列表框控件(ListBox) 43
2.4.7组合框控件(ComboBox) 48
2.4.8滚动条控件(ScrollBar) 51
2.4.9框架控件(Frame) 54
2.4.10计时器控件(Timer) 54
2.4.11图片框控件(PictureBox) 57
2.4.12图像控件(Image) 60
2.4.13窗体 61
2.5向窗体添加控件 67
2.5.1在窗体上添加一个控件 67
2.5.2控件的缩放和移动 67
2.5.3控件的复制与删除 68
2.5.4控件的对齐和排列 68
2.6代码设计窗口 71
2.6.1打开代码窗口的方法 71
2.6.2代码窗口的结构 71
2.6.3查看代码的方式 72
2.6.4代码设计器提供的功能 72
2.7工程管理 73
2.7.1 VB工程的组成 73
2.7.2建立、打开及保存工程 74
2.7.3在工程中添加、删除及保存文件 76
2.7.4运行工程 77
2.8 VB编程基本步骤 80
2.8.1新建工程 80
2.8.2向窗体添加控件 80
2.8.3设置控件属性 80
2.8.4编写代码 81
2.8.5运行、调试工程 81
2.8.6保存工程 81
2.8.7编译工程 82
第3章 VB编程基础 88
3.1标识符 89
3.2基本数据类型 90
3.2.1数值型数据 91
3.2.2字符型数据String 92
3.2.3布尔型数据Boolean 93
3.2.4日期型数据Date 93
3.2.5对象型数据Object 93
3.2.6变体型数据Variant 93
3.3数据类型转换 95
3.4常量与变量 96
3.4.1常量 96
3.4.2变量 97
3.5算术运算符和表达式 101
3.5.1算术运算符 101
3.5.2算术表达式书写规则 102
3.5.3算术运算符的优先级 103
3.6字符串运算符和字符串表达式 103
3.6.1字符串运算符 103
3.6.2字符串表达式 104
3.7日期运算符和日期表达式 104
3.7.1日期运算符 104
3.7.2日期表达式 104
3.8关系运算符和关系表达式 105
3.8.1关系运算符 105
3.8.2关系表达式 105
3.9逻辑运算符和逻辑表达式 106
3.9.1逻辑运算符 106
3.9.2逻辑表达式 107
3.9.3 3种运算符之间的运算优先级的关系 108
3.10常用内部函数 109
3.10.1数学函数 109
3.10.2字符串函数 110
3.10.3判断函数 110
3.10.4日期和时间函数 110
3.11 VB语句的书写规则 110
3.11.1赋值语句 111
3.11.2注释语句 112
3.11.3语句续行 112
3.11.4一行中书写多条语句 113
3.11.5命令格式中的符号说明 113
3.12记录类型数据(用户自定义类型) 113
3.12.1记录类型的定义 114
3.12.2定义记录类型变量 115
3.12.3记录类型变量的赋值 115
第4章 数据信息的基本输入输出 122
4.1数据输出 123
4.1.1输出文本信息到窗体 123
4.1.2输出文本信息到图片框 128
4.1.3使用标签控件输出文本信息 129
4.1.4使用消息框输出文本信息 131
4.1.5使用格式化函数输出 134
4.2数据输入 137
4.2.1使用文本框控件输入信息和数据 137
4.2.2使用输入框输入 141
4.3其他常用语句 143
4.3.1卸载对象语句 143
4.3.2焦点与Tab键序 144
第5章 选择结构设计 153
5.1程序的基本结构 154
5.1.1顺序结构 154
5.1.2选择结构 155
5.1.3循环结构 155
5.2单条件选择语句If 156
5.2.1单行结构条件语句 156
5.2.2块形式的IF…Then语句 159
5.2.3 If语句的嵌套 160
5.3多分支选择结构Select Case语句 165
5.4应用程序设计示例 169
第6章 循环结构设计 184
6.1 For…Next循环语句 185
6.1.1 For…Next语句的语法格式 186
6.1.2 For…Next语句的执行过程 186
6.1.3 For…Next循环的循环次数 187
6.1.4 For…Next语句的嵌套 191
6.2 Do…Loop循环语句 194
6.2.1当型(前测型)Do…Loop循环语句语法格式 194
6.2.2直到型(后测型)Do…Loop循环语句 196
6.3 While…Wend循环语句 198
6.4应用程序设计示例 199
第7章 数组 227
7.1数组的概念 228
7.1.1数组的定义与声明 229
7.1.2用Option Base语句定义数组下标下界缺省值 229
7.1.3对数组元素的引用 230
7.1.4动态数组 230
7.1.5数组的维数 231
7.1.6对数组元素的操作 232
7.2控件数组 241
7.2.1控件数组的概念 242
7.2.2建立控件数组的方法 242
7.2.3控件数组的使用 243
第8章 过程 263
8.1子程序过程 264
8.1.1事件过程 265
8.1.2通用过程 266
8.1.3通用过程的创建和定义 266
8.1.4通用过程的调用 269
8.2函数过程(Function过程) 275
8.2.1函数过程的定义 275
8.2.2函数过程的调用 277
8.3参数的传递 282
8.3.1形式参数和实际参数 282
8.3.2数值传递与地址传递 283
8.3.3使用可选参数 288
8.3.4提供可选参数的默认值 289
8.3.5使用不定数量的参数 289
第9章 VB绘图程序设计方法 300
9.1坐标系统和颜色 301
9.1.1标准VB坐标系 301
9.1.2自定义坐标系 303
9.1.3坐标度量转换 307
9.1.4使用颜色 307
9.2绘图控件介绍 310
9.2.1线条控件 310
9.2.2形状控件 311
9.3绘图命令介绍 313
9.3.1清除屏幕图像命令Cls 313
9.3.2画点命令PSet 313
9.3.3画直线和矩形命令Line 317
9.3.4画圆和椭圆命令Circle 319
9.4图像应用程序中常用方法 321
9.4.1图像属性设置 321
9.4.2图片的加载 321
9.4.3图片的移动 323
9.5图形的变换 323
9.6绘图程序设计案例 326
第10章 文件处理 339
10.1文件的基本概念和分类 340
10.2文件的输入输出操作 341
10.2.1顺序文件的读写操作 341
10.2.2随机文件的读写操作 350
10.2.3二进制文件 355
10.3常用文件系统操作控件 356
10.3.1 DriverListBox控件 356
10.3.2 DirList控件 358
10.3.3 FileListBox控件 359
10.3.4 VB中常用文件处理语句和函数 362
第11章 数据库程序设计 377
11.1数据库的基本概念 378
11.1.1关系数据库的基本结构 379
11.1.2 VB数据访问对象及数据库访问机制 379
11.2 Access数据库 381
11.2.1创建Access数据库 382
11.2.2创建Access数据表 383
11.2.3修改表结构 385
11.2.4输入记录数据 385
11.3使用数据控件Data 385
11.3.1 Data控件的属性 385
11.3.2数据绑定控件常用属性 387
11.3.3 Data控件的事件 390
11.3.4 Data控件的方法 390
11.3.5数据记录对象(Recordset) 391
11.4使用数据库表格控件DBGrid 408
11.4.1给工具箱增加DBGrid控件 408
11.4.2 DBGrid控件中表的修改 409
11.4.3 DBGrid控件的运用 412
11.5使用ADO Data控件 414
11.5.1 ADO控件的常用属性 415
11.5.2 ADO Data控件的方法 418
11.5.3 ADO Data控件的应用例子 419
11.6使用“数据窗体设计器”进行界面设计 424
11.7结构化查询语言(SQL) 429
11.7.1 SQL语言的组成 430
11.7.2数据查询语句 430
11.7.3使用SQL 431
第12章 调试与错误处理 437
12.1程序的错误类型 438
12.2程序调试 440
12.2.1 VB系统的工作模式 440
12.2.2调试工具 441
12.2.3程序调试的方法 442
12.2.4调试示例 444
12.3使用调试窗口 449
12.3.1立即窗口 449
12.3.2本地窗口 450
12.3.3调用堆栈窗口 450
12.3.4用监视表达式监视程序 450
12.4错误捕获及处理 452
12.4.1 On Error Goto…Resume结构 452
12.4.2 On Error Goto…Resume Next语句 453
12.4.3 Resume与Resume Next的区别 455
12.5条件编译 456
12.5.1条件编译语句 457
12.5.2使用条件编译调试程序 458
参考文献 461
- 《指向核心素养 北京十一学校名师教学设计 英语 七年级 上 配人教版》周志英总主编 2019
- 《设计十六日 国内外美术院校报考攻略》沈海泯著 2018
- 《计算机辅助平面设计》吴轶博主编 2019
- 《高校转型发展系列教材 素描基础与设计》施猛责任编辑;(中国)魏伏一,徐红 2019
- 《景观艺术设计》林春水,马俊 2019
- 《程序逻辑及C语言编程》卢卫中,杨丽芳主编 2019
- 《复旦大学新闻学院教授学术丛书 新闻实务随想录》刘海贵 2019
- 《高等院校保险学专业系列教材 保险学原理与实务》林佳依责任编辑;(中国)牟晓伟,李彤宇 2019
- 《高等教育双机械基础课程系列教材 高等学校教材 机械设计课程设计手册 第5版》吴宗泽,罗圣国,高志,李威 2018
- 《指向核心素养 北京十一学校名师教学设计 英语 九年级 上 配人教版》周志英总主编 2019
- 《高考快速作文指导》张吉武,鲍志伸主编 2002
- 《建筑施工企业统计》杨淑芝主编 2008
- 《钒产业技术及应用》高峰,彭清静,华骏主编 2019
- 《近代旅游指南汇刊二编 16》王强主编 2017
- 《汉语词汇知识与习得研究》邢红兵主编 2019
- 《东北民歌文化研究及艺术探析》(中国)杨清波 2019
- 《黄遵宪集 4》陈铮主编 2019
- 《孙诒让集 1》丁进主编 2016
- 《近代世界史文献丛编 19》王强主编 2017
- 《激光加工实训技能指导理实一体化教程 下》王秀军,徐永红主编;刘波,刘克生副主编 2017
- 《大学计算机实验指导及习题解答》曹成志,宋长龙 2019
- 《中央财政支持提升专业服务产业发展能力项目水利工程专业课程建设成果 设施农业工程技术》赵英编 2018
- 《指向核心素养 北京十一学校名师教学设计 英语 七年级 上 配人教版》周志英总主编 2019
- 《大学生心理健康与人生发展》王琳责任编辑;(中国)肖宇 2019
- 《大学英语四级考试全真试题 标准模拟 四级》汪开虎主编 2012
- 《大学英语教学的跨文化交际视角研究与创新发展》许丽云,刘枫,尚利明著 2020
- 《北京生态环境保护》《北京环境保护丛书》编委会编著 2018
- 《复旦大学新闻学院教授学术丛书 新闻实务随想录》刘海贵 2019
- 《大学英语综合教程 1》王佃春,骆敏主编 2015
- 《大学物理简明教程 下 第2版》施卫主编 2020